Ingredients
To create this divine Chocolate Crepe Cake, you will need the following ingredients:
1. Crepe batter ingredients: eggs, milk, flour, sugar, salt
2. Chocolate ganache ingredients: dark chocolate, heavy cream, butter
3. Optional toppings: fresh berries, whipped cream, cocoa powder
Feel free to substitute dark chocolate for milk chocolate if you prefer a sweeter flavor profile. You can also use almond milk or coconut milk as dairy alternatives in the crepe batter.
Step-by-Step Instructions
Follow these simple steps to create your Chocolate Crepe Cake masterpiece:
1. Prepare the crepe batter by whisking together eggs, milk, flour, sugar, and salt until smooth.
2. Heat a non-stick pan over medium heat and pour a ladleful of batter, swirling the pan to create a thin, even layer. Cook each crepe for about 1-2 minutes per side until golden brown.
3. In a saucepan, melt dark chocolate, heavy cream, and butter to create a silky ganache. Let it cool slightly before assembly.
4. Place a crepe on a serving plate and spread a thin layer of ganache. Repeat this process, layering crepes and ganache until you reach your desired height.
5. Refrigerate the cake for at least 2 hours to set before serving. Garnish with your favorite toppings before slicing and enjoying!
Expert Tips for Success
For the perfect Chocolate Crepe Cake, consider these expert tips:
1. Use a non-stick pan to prevent the crepes from sticking and tearing during cooking.
2. Let the crepe batter rest for at least 30 minutes to ensure a smooth and consistent texture.
3. Be patient when layering the cake to avoid any sliding or collapsing. Refrigeration helps set the ganache and stabilize the layers.
4. Experiment with different chocolate percentages to achieve your preferred level of richness and bitterness in the ganache.
Variations and Substitutions
Get creative with these variations and substitutions for your Chocolate Crepe Cake:
1. Add a splash of rum or coffee liqueur to the ganache for a boozy twist.
2. Incorporate layers of flavored whipped cream between the crepes for added lightness and flavor diversity.
3. Swap the dark chocolate for white chocolate for a sweeter and creamier alternative.
4. For a dairy-free version, use vegan dark chocolate, coconut cream, and dairy-free butter in the ganache.

FAQs
Here are answers to common questions you may have about making Chocolate Crepe Cake:
Q: Can I make the crepes in advance?
A: Yes, you can make the crepes ahead of time and store them in the refrigerator with parchment paper between each layer to prevent sticking.
Q: How long will the Chocolate Crepe Cake last?
A: The cake can be refrigerated for up to 2 days, but it is best enjoyed fresh for optimal taste and texture.

Ingredients
- 3 eggs
- 2 cups milk
- 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1/4 cup sugar
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 10 oz dark chocolate
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1/4 cup butter
- Optional: fresh berries, whipped cream, cocoa powder
Directions
-
Prepare the crepe batter by whisking together eggs, milk, flour, sugar, and salt until smooth.
-
Heat a non-stick pan over medium heat and pour a ladleful of batter, swirling the pan to create a thin, even layer. Cook each crepe for about 1-2 minutes per side until golden brown.
-
In a saucepan, melt dark chocolate, heavy cream, and butter to create a silky ganache. Let it cool slightly before assembly.
-
Place a crepe on a serving plate and spread a thin layer of ganache. Repeat this process, layering crepes and ganache until you reach your desired height.
-
Refrigerate the cake for at least 2 hours to set before serving. Garnish with your favorite toppings before slicing and enjoying!
